La présente invention concerne un dispositif de convoyage d'objets tels que, notamment, bouteilles, flacons ou autres. The present invention relates to a device for conveying objects such as, in particular, bottles, flasks or the like.
Toutefois, bien que plus particulièrement prévue pour de telles applications, elle pourra également être destinée, de manière générale, à tout objet présentant une extrémité munie d'une excroissance. However, although more particularly intended for such applications, it may also be intended, in general, for any object having an end provided with a protuberance.
Actuellement, dans le domaine du convoyage, il est connu de transporter les bouteilles par soufflage d'un flux d'air sur une ou plusieurs parties de leur surface et d'assurer ainsi leur déplacement selon une direction donnée. Currently, in the field of conveying, it is known to transport the bottles by blowing an air flow over one or more parts of their surface and thus ensuring their movement in a given direction.
D'après un mode de réalisation préférentiel de ce procédé, lesdites bouteilles sont propulsées par un jet d'air agissant au niveau de leur goulot. According to a preferred embodiment of this process, said bottles are propelled by an air jet acting at their neck.
Les dispositifs correspondant comprennent généralement une chambre de soufflage et un rail support. La chambre de soufflage est alimentée par des ventilateurs et permet de comprimer l'air introduit, ce dernier étant ensuite projeté en direction du goulot des bouteilles par l'intermédiaire de fentes, prévues à la surface de ladite chambre de soufflage. The corresponding devices generally include a blowing chamber and a support rail. The blowing chamber is supplied by fans and makes it possible to compress the air introduced, the latter then being projected towards the neck of the bottles by means of slots, provided on the surface of said blowing chamber.
La structure desdites fentes permet d'orienter le flux d'air projeté et d'assurer ainsi le transport des bouteilles selon la direction souhaitée. The structure of said slots makes it possible to orient the projected air flow and thus ensure the transport of the bottles in the desired direction.
Le rail support coopère avec une excroissance prévue au niveau du goulot des bouteilles convoyées et participe à leur guidage. II est généralement assujetti à la face inférieure de la chambre de soufflage, aussi appelée tablier. The support rail cooperates with a protrusion provided at the neck of the conveyed bottles and participates in their guidance. It is generally subject to the underside of the blowing chamber, also called an apron.
Afin d'améliorer le guidage des bouteilles, les dispositifs décrits ci-dessus comportent habituellement, en outre, des guides latéraux, en vis-àvis de la trajectoire du corps desdites bouteilles. Dans la plupart des installations connues, ils sont assujettis au tablier. In order to improve the guidance of the bottles, the devices described above usually additionally comprise lateral guides, facing the trajectory of the body of said bottles. In most known installations, they are subject to the apron.
Afin d'être efficaces, il est à noter que lesdits guides latéraux nécessitent le plus souvent un réglage fin et minutieux, adapté à chaque profil de bouteille transportée. In order to be effective, it should be noted that said lateral guides most often require a fine and meticulous adjustment, adapted to each profile of the bottle transported.
Bien que ces procédés de convoyage constituent une solution offrant de nombreux avantages pour le transfert de bouteilles, les dispositifs actuellement connus présentent toutefois des inconvénients. En effet, leur chambre de soufflage est monobloc et n'est donc pas facilement accessible. Although these conveying methods constitute a solution offering numerous advantages for the transfer of bottles, the devices currently known however have drawbacks. Indeed, their blowing chamber is in one piece and is therefore not easily accessible.
En conséquence, elle ne peut pas être facilement ni rapidement nettoyée alors que dans les domaines où lesdits dispositifs sont employés, à savoir notamment l'industrie agro-alimentaire, les exigences en matière d'hygiène sont de plus en plus élevées. Consequently, it cannot be easily or quickly cleaned while in the fields where said devices are used, namely in particular the food industry, the requirements in terms of hygiene are increasingly high.
Le but de la présente invention est de proposer un dispositif de convoyage d'objets présentant une excroissance au niveau de leur goulot, comprenant une chambre de soufflage, qui pallie les inconvénients précités et dont ladite chambre de soufflage soit facilement accessible notamment afin de simplifier son nettoyage. The object of the present invention is to provide a device for conveying objects having a protuberance at their neck, comprising a blowing chamber, which overcomes the aforementioned drawbacks and of which said blowing chamber is easily accessible in particular in order to simplify its cleaning.
Un autre but de la présente invention est de proposer un dispositif de convoyage d'objets présentant une excroissance au niveau de leur goulot, comprenant une chambre de soufflage et des guides latéraux des objets transportés, qui permette de nettoyer ladite chambre de soufflage sans altérer le réglage desdits guides latéraux et engendrer des gains de temps d'entretien. Another object of the present invention is to provide a device for conveying objects having a protuberance at their neck, comprising a blowing chamber and lateral guides of the transported objects, which makes it possible to clean said blowing chamber without altering the adjustment of said lateral guides and generate maintenance time savings.
Un autre but de la présente invention est de proposer un dispositif de convoyage qui ne présente pas de zone qui puisse entraîner des rétentions de salissure. Another object of the present invention is to provide a conveying device which does not have an area which can cause dirt retention.
Un autre but de la présente invention est de proposer un dispositif de convoyage dont la robustesse soit améliorée. Another object of the present invention is to provide a conveying device whose robustness is improved.
Un avantage de la présente invention est d'être facilement modulable et de pouvoir s'intégrer sans difficulté dans une installation industrielle. An advantage of the present invention is to be easily modular and to be able to integrate without difficulty into an industrial installation.
Un autre avantage de la présente invention est de présenter un réglage simplifié. Another advantage of the present invention is to present a simplified adjustment.
D'autres buts et avantages de la présente invention apparaîtront au cours de la description qui va suivre qui n'est donnée qu'à titre indicatif et qui n'a pas pour but de la limiter. Other objects and advantages of the present invention will appear during the description which follows which is given only for information and which is not intended to limit it.
La présente invention concerne un dispositif de convoyage d'objets tels que, notamment, bouteilles, flacons ou autres, présentant une excroissance au niveau de leur goulot, comprenant une chambre de soufflage, permettant la projection d'un flux d'air apte à entraîner lesdits objets, et un rail support, coopérant avec lesdits objets au niveau de ladite excroissance, caractérisé par le fait que ladite chambre est constituée d'un corps et d'un tablier, amovible par rapport audit corps, ledit rail support étant assujetti audit tablier. The present invention relates to a device for conveying objects such as, in particular, bottles, flasks or the like, having a protuberance at their neck, comprising a blowing chamber, allowing the projection of an air flow capable of entraining said objects, and a support rail, cooperating with said objects at said protuberance, characterized in that said chamber consists of a body and an apron, removable relative to said body, said support rail being subject to said apron .

Comme représenté à la figure 1, le dispositif de convoyage conforme à l'invention permet de transporter des objets 1 présentant une excroissance 2, notamment annulaire, au niveau de leur goulot 3, par exemple selon une direction sensiblement orthogonale au plan de la figure. As shown in FIG. 1, the conveying device according to the invention makes it possible to transport objects 1 having a protuberance 2, in particular annular, at their neck 3, for example in a direction substantially orthogonal to the plane of the figure.
Pour cela, de manière connue, ledit dispositif comprend une chambre de soufflage 4, permettant la projection d'un flux d'air apte à entraîner lesdits objets 1, selon la direction de convoyage souhaitée. II comprend également un rail support 5, coopérant avec lesdits objets 1 au niveau de leur excroissance 2, ledit rail support 5 étant orienté selon ladite direction de convoyage. For this, in known manner, said device comprises a blowing chamber 4, allowing the projection of an air flow capable of driving said objects 1, according to the desired conveying direction. It also comprises a support rail 5, cooperating with said objects 1 at their protuberance 2, said support rail 5 being oriented in said conveying direction.
Grâce au dispositif conforme à l'invention, lesdits objets 1, dirigés sensiblement verticalement, sont ainsi transférés sous ladite chambre de soufflage 4, par exemple. d'une installation de mise en forme à une installation de remplissage. Thanks to the device according to the invention, said objects 1, directed substantially vertically, are thus transferred under said blowing chamber 4, for example. from a shaping plant to a filling plant.
Ladite chambre de soufflage 4 présente, notamment, au niveau de sa face inférieure un canal 6 muni de fentes, par exemple, sur ses parois latérales. Lesdites fentes non représentées sur la figure, sont aptes à permettre la projection dudit flux d'air en direction du goulot 3 des objets 1, ce dernier circulant dans ledit canal. Said blowing chamber 4 has, in particular, at its lower face a channel 6 provided with slots, for example, on its side walls. Said slots not shown in the figure, are capable of allowing the projection of said air flow towards the neck 3 of the objects 1, the latter circulating in said channel.
Ledit rail support 5 est constitué, notamment, de deux rampes supérieures 30, en plastique et/ou en acier inoxydable qui, avec le flux d'air orienté, permettent de guider lesdits objets 1 le long de leur trajet. Said support rail 5 consists, in particular, of two upper ramps 30, made of plastic and / or stainless steel which, with the air flow oriented, make it possible to guide said objects 1 along their path.
Selon l'invention, ladite chambre 4 est constituée d'un corps 7 et d'un tablier 8, amovible par rapport audit corps 7. Ledit rail support 5 est assujetti audit tablier 8, ce dernier définissant également, notamment, ledit canal 6. According to the invention, said chamber 4 consists of a body 7 and an apron 8, removable relative to said body 7. Said support rail 5 is secured to said apron 8, the latter also defining, in particular, said channel 6.
La chambre de soufflage 4 est ainsi facilement accessible, par démontage dudit tablier 8, et son nettoyage ainsi que l'évacuation des produits utilisés à cette fin sont simplifiés. The blowing chamber 4 is thus easily accessible, by dismantling said apron 8, and its cleaning and the removal of the products used for this purpose are simplified.
Selon le mode de réalisation illustré, le dispositif conforme à l'invention, comprend des traverses de soutien 9, solidaires dudit corps 7 notamment prévues à l'intérieur de ce dernier, ledit tablier 8 étant assujetti auxdites traverses 9 de manière amovible. II comprend également des moyens 10 pour assurer l'étanchéité de la liaison entre ledit tablier 8 et ledit corps 7. According to the illustrated embodiment, the device according to the invention comprises support crosspieces 9, integral with said body 7 in particular provided inside the latter, said apron 8 being subject to said crosspieces 9 in a removable manner. It also includes means 10 for sealing the connection between said deck 8 and said body 7.
Ladite chambre de soufflage 4 est prévue, par exemple, sensiblement quadrangulaire et ledit corps 7 est constitué, notamment, de deux flancs latéraux , 12, et d'un couvercle 13. Said blowing chamber 4 is provided, for example, substantially quadrangular and said body 7 consists, in particular, of two lateral sides, 12, and of a cover 13.
Lesdites traverses de soutien 9 s'étendent, par exemple, entre lesdits flancs latéraux 11, 12, et sont prévues régulièrement espacées le long de la chambre de soufflage 4, selon la direction de convoyage des objets 1. Said support crosspieces 9 extend, for example, between said lateral flanks 11, 12, and are provided regularly spaced along the blowing chamber 4, in the conveying direction of the objects 1.
Lesdits moyens 10 pour assurer l'étanchéité sont constitués, notamment, par deux longerons 14,15, prévus latéralement le long dudit corps 7 et solidaires de manière étanche avec ledit corps 7, et par des joints 16, prévus le long dudit tablier 8, aptes à coopérer avec lesdits longerons 14,15. Said means 10 for sealing are constituted, in particular, by two longitudinal members 14,15, provided laterally along said body 7 and integral in leaktight manner with said body 7, and by seals 16, provided along said deck 8, able to cooperate with said beams 14.15.
Ces derniers permettent ainsi d'assurer une liaison étanche entre ledit corps 7 et ledit tablier 8 et éviter toute déperdition d'air nuisible à la qualité du soufflage. The latter thus make it possible to ensure a sealed connection between said body 7 and said apron 8 and to avoid any loss of air detrimental to the quality of the blowing.
Lesdits longerons 14, 15, orientés selon la direction de convoyage, sont solidaires, par exemple, des flancs latéraux 11, 12 du corps 7 et sont prévus à l'extérieur de ce dernier. Quant aux joints 16, ils sont prévus sur les bords longitudinaux dudit tablier 8. Said beams 14, 15, oriented in the conveying direction, are secured, for example, to the lateral flanks 11, 12 of the body 7 and are provided outside of the latter. As for the seals 16, they are provided on the longitudinal edges of said deck 8.
Selon le mode particulier de réalisation illustré, lesdits longerons 14, 15 présentent au moins une gorge 17, apte à accueillir lesdits joints 16. Ledit corps 7 est pris en sandwich entre lesdits longerons 14, 15 et ladite traverse 9, prévus solidaires entre eux. According to the particular embodiment illustrated, said longitudinal members 14, 15 have at least one groove 17, capable of receiving said seals 16. Said body 7 is sandwiched between said longitudinal members 14, 15 and said cross member 9, provided integral with each other.
Afin de favoriser le guidage des objets 1, le dispositif conforme à l'invention comprend, en outre, par exemple, des guides latéraux 19, notamment constitués au moins d'une rampe de guidage 20, prévue le long dudit dispositif, en vis-à-vis du corps desdits objets 1 et des tiges support 31 de ladite rampe de guidage 20. La position transversale desdites rampes de guidage 20 est, par exemple, réglable selon la direction des flèches repérées 21 tandis que la position verticale desdites rampes 20 est, par exemple, réglable selon la direction des flèches repérées 22. In order to promote the guiding of objects 1, the device according to the invention further comprises, for example, lateral guides 19, in particular consisting of at least one guide ramp 20, provided along said device, facing with respect to the body of said objects 1 and to the support rods 31 of said guide ramp 20. The transverse position of said guide ramps 20 is, for example, adjustable in the direction of the arrows marked 21 while the vertical position of said ramps 20 is , for example, adjustable according to the direction of the arrows marked 22.
Selon le mode de réalisation illustré, lesdits guides latéraux 19 et ledit tablier 8 sont indépendants et permettent ainsi de pouvoir accéder, après démontage dudit tablier 8, à l'intérieur de la chambre de soufflage 4 sans risquer de dérégler lesdits guides latéraux 19, cela permettant un gain de temps lors de l'entretien. According to the illustrated embodiment, said lateral guides 19 and said apron 8 are independent and thus allow access, after dismantling of said apron 8, to the interior of the blowing chamber 4 without risking disrupting said lateral guides 19, this saving time during maintenance.
Pour cela, lesdits longerons 14, 15 sont, par exemple, aptes à supporter lesdits guides latéraux 19. A cette fin, ils sont munis, notamment, de logements 23 par l'intermédiaire desquels lesdits guides latéraux 19 sont assujettis auxdits longerons 14, 15 au niveau des extrémités supérieures des tiges support 31. For this, said beams 14, 15 are, for example, capable of supporting said lateral guides 19. To this end, they are provided, in particular, with housings 23 by means of which said lateral guides 19 are subject to said beams 14, 15 at the upper ends of the support rods 31.
Ainsi, lesdits longerons 14, 15 permettent, à la fois, d'assurer l'étanchéité entre le corps 7 et le tablier amovible 8, grâce auxdites gorges 17, ainsi que de supporter, notamment, lesdits guides latéraux 19, indépendamment dudit tablier amovible 8, grâce auxdits logements 23. Ils rendent, en outre, le dispositif conforme à l'invention plus modulaire. Thus, said beams 14, 15 allow, at the same time, to ensure the seal between the body 7 and the removable deck 8, thanks to said grooves 17, as well as to support, in particular, said lateral guides 19, independently of said removable deck 8, thanks to said housings 23. They also make the device according to the invention more modular.
Selon le mode de réalisation illustré, lesdits longerons 14, 15 sont de section sensiblement quadrangulaire et la ou les gorges 17 sont prévues sur leur face latérale intérieure, c'est-à-dire celles se trouvant en vis-àvis de la trajectoire des objets 1. According to the illustrated embodiment, said longitudinal members 14, 15 are of substantially quadrangular section and the groove or grooves 17 are provided on their inner lateral face, that is to say those located opposite the trajectory of objects 1.
Quant aux logements 23, ils sont situés, par exemple, sur leur face inférieure. As for the housings 23, they are located, for example, on their underside.
Lesdits longerons 14, 15 présentent, en outre, notamment, un ou des logements secondaires 32, aptes à permettre le maintien du dispositif par le sol et/ou le plafond du local dans lequel il est installé. Ils peuvent également être munis, éventuellement, d'une rainure 33, apte à permettre l'encastrement d'éventuelles joues 36. Said beams 14, 15 also have, in particular, one or more secondary housings 32, capable of allowing the device to be held by the floor and / or the ceiling of the room in which it is installed. They may also be provided, optionally, with a groove 33, capable of allowing the embedding of any cheeks 36.
Lesdits logements secondaires 32 sont prévus, par exemple, sur la face latérale extérieure desdits logements 14, 15 tandis que lesdites rainures 33 sont situées sur leur côté inférieur. Said secondary housings 32 are provided, for example, on the external lateral face of said housings 14, 15 while said grooves 33 are situated on their lower side.
De plus, lesdits longerons 14, 15 et ladite traverse 9 sont assujettis les uns aux autres, notamment, par l'intermédiaire d'un système visécrou dans lequel la tête de la vis coopère avec au moins un troisième logement 34, prévu dans lesdits longerons 14, 15. In addition, said beams 14, 15 and said cross member 9 are subject to each other, in particular, by means of a screw-nut system in which the head of the screw cooperates with at least one third housing 34, provided in said beams. 14, 15.
Lesdits longerons 14, 15 sont constitués, par exemple , d'un profilé en aluminium présentant, notamment, une face supérieure incurvée de manière à éviter l'accumulation de salissures. Said beams 14, 15 consist, for example, of an aluminum profile having, in particular, a curved upper face so as to avoid the accumulation of dirt.
Selon le mode particulier de réalisation illustré, lesdites tiges support 31 et ladite rampe de guidage 20 coopère entre eux par articulation en rotation pour assurer le réglage de la position transversale de ladite rampe de guidage 20 par rapport auxdits objets 1, notamment en fonction de la section horizontale de ces derniers. According to the particular embodiment illustrated, said support rods 31 and said guide ramp 20 cooperate with one another by articulation in rotation to ensure the adjustment of the transverse position of said guide ramp 20 relative to said objects 1, in particular as a function of the horizontal section of these.
Plus précisément, lesdites tiges support 31 sont, par exemple, articulables en rotation autour d'axes sensiblement verticaux 40 et ladite rampe de guidage 20 est articulable en rotation par rapport à des axes 41, sensiblement verticaux, excentrés par rapport auxdits axes de rotation 40 des tiges 31 et assujettis auxdites tiges 31. More specifically, said support rods 31 are, for example, articulated in rotation about substantially vertical axes 40 and said guide ramp 20 is articulated in rotation relative to axes 41, substantially vertical, eccentric relative to said axes of rotation 40 rods 31 and subject to said rods 31.
Ainsi, selon le décalage angulaire choisi, I'extrémité distale de la rampe de guidage 20 est plus ou moins éloignée desdits objets 1 tandis que sa tige support 31 ou la partie de la tige support 31 se trouvant le long dudit axe de rotation 40 reste dans la même position. Thus, according to the angular offset chosen, the distal end of the guide ramp 20 is more or less distant from said objects 1 while its support rod 31 or the part of the support rod 31 lying along said axis of rotation 40 remains in the same position.
Un tel mouvement de rotation permet de simplifier le réglage desdits guides latéraux 19, notamment en cas de présence de joues 36. Such a rotational movement makes it possible to simplify the adjustment of said lateral guides 19, in particular in the presence of cheeks 36.
Selon le mode de réalisation illustré, ladite tige support 31 desdits guides latéraux 19 se présente, par exemple, sous la forme d'un U,
I'une des branches se trouvant le long dudit axe de rotation 40 et l'autre permettant d'assurer le positionnement vertical desdites rampes de guidage 20, articulées en rotation autour de ladite autre branche.According to the illustrated embodiment, said support rod 31 of said lateral guides 19 is, for example, in the form of a U,
One of the branches being along said axis of rotation 40 and the other making it possible to ensure the vertical positioning of said guide ramps 20, articulated in rotation around said other branch.
Cela étant, ledit tablier 8 est assujetti à ladite traverse 9, notamment, par l'intermédiaire d'au moins une vis 24 et, avantageusement, grâce à deux dites vis 24, décalées par rapport à l'axe de symétrie 25 des objets I convoyés, afin d'éviter. les chocs au niveau de la zone supérieure du goulot. Lesdites vis 24 sont prévues, notamment, au niveau du canal 6 dans lequel circule le goulot 3 desdits objets 1, prévu dans la partie médiane dudit tablier 8. However, said deck 8 is subject to said cross member 9, in particular, by means of at least one screw 24 and, advantageously, by means of two said screws 24, offset with respect to the axis of symmetry 25 of the objects I conveyed, in order to avoid. shocks at the upper neck area. Said screws 24 are provided, in particular, at the level of channel 6 in which the neck 3 of said objects 1 circulates, provided in the middle part of said apron 8.
II est à noter que la présente structure permet de renforcer la robustesse du dispositif et, notamment, d'éviter le déréglage des rampes supérieures 30 constituant le rail 5. It should be noted that the present structure makes it possible to reinforce the robustness of the device and, in particular, to avoid the adjustment of the upper ramps 30 constituting the rail 5.
En effet, lors du passage de trains de bouteilles, flacons ou autres, à grande vitesse, ceux-ci peuvent exercer de fortes contraintes sur les guides latéraux 19. Dans les dispositifs antérieurement connus, ces efforts sont directement reportés sur le tablier tandis que, selon l'invention, lesdits efforts sont repris par l'armature de soutien 9, au niveau de ses extrémités latérales, et ne portent donc pas sur ledit tablier 8, empêchant ainsi le déréglage des rampes supérieures 30. Indeed, when passing trains of bottles, flasks or the like, at high speed, these can exert strong stresses on the lateral guides 19. In the previously known devices, these forces are directly transferred to the bulkhead while, according to the invention, said forces are taken up by the support frame 9, at its lateral ends, and therefore do not bear on said deck 8, thus preventing the upper ramps 30 from being adjusted.
Par ailleurs, selon le mode particulier de réalisation illustré, le couvercle 13 dudit corps 7 est prévu, éventuellement, en U définissant ainsi une goulotte 26 entre lesdits flancs latéraux 11, 12 dudit corps 7. Cette dernière pourra permettre, notamment, de loger différents câbles électriques et/ou autres et être obturée à sa partie supérieure. Furthermore, according to the particular embodiment illustrated, the cover 13 of said body 7 is provided, optionally, in a U shape thus defining a chute 26 between said lateral flanks 11, 12 of said body 7. The latter may in particular be able to accommodate different electric cables and / or others and be closed at its upper part.
L'intérêt d'une telle disposition est qu'elle permet d'éviter d'utiliser une goulotte indépendante, située au-dessus et/ou à côté de la chambre de soufflage 4, et par suite de définir un interstice où pourraient s'accumuler des salissures. The advantage of such an arrangement is that it makes it possible to avoid using an independent chute, located above and / or next to the blowing chamber 4, and consequently to define an interstice where could accumulate soiling.
Lesdites traverses de soutien 9 sont constituées, par exemple, par la branche inférieure d'un arceau 27, éventuellement en deux parties, assujettie audit couvercle 13. Ledit arceau 27 longe, notamment, lesdits flancs latéraux 11, 12 du corps 7 et présente des points d'accrochage 35 avec ledit couvercle 13. Said support crosspieces 9 are constituted, for example, by the lower branch of a hoop 27, possibly in two parts, secured to said cover 13. Said hoop 27 runs, in particular, said lateral flanks 11, 12 of the body 7 and has attachment points 35 with said cover 13.
Lesdits points d'accrochage 35 pourront servir, en outre, éventuellement de points de maintien du dispositif au plafond du local dans lequel il est installé, notamment par l'intermédiaire de tiges non représentées sur la présente figure. Said attachment points 35 may also serve, optionally, as points for holding the device on the ceiling of the room in which it is installed, in particular by means of rods not shown in this figure.
L'invention permet ainsi de diminuer la visserie extérieure. The invention thus makes it possible to reduce the external screws.
